- Oven selection
The Oven is an essential basic item for baking. Depending on the nature of the work, there are different options for home use, studio use, and commercial use.
The Oven is a piece of equipment that retains its value. To save costs, you can also buy a used Oven and look for professional brand equipment.

Household Oven:
Capacity: 38L or more.
Temperature control: It is best to independently control the temperature of the upper and lower fires.
For studio use:
Capacity: Single layer single tray Oven.
Commercial Oven:
Capacity: single layer, multi-layer. Power: 380V, electric or gas.
Regarding the steam function of the Oven, if you need to make European-style bread, it is a must-have function of the Oven; it is best to have a stone slab; if it is just ordinary bread, cakes, mousse, etc., you do not need to consider the steam function.
- Commercial Freezer

There are two types of commercial refrigerators: air cooling and direct cooling.
Air-cooled refrigerators use the principle of air-blown refrigeration and do not form frost, but the products are prone to drying; direct-cooling refrigerators have better freezing effects, but are prone to frost and require regular de-icing.
Operating a desktop refrigerator saves more space.
